EA Motive’s Iron Man Game – Dinosaur Comics Creator Joins Writing Team

Eisner Award-winning author is "pretty stoked" and added, "You are not ready for how amazing this game is going to be."

EA Motive Studio’s Iron Man game is still in early pre-production, with Unreal Engine 5 being used over Frostbite. In a recent tweet, author Ryan North announced he’s part of the writing team for the upcoming superhero title, adding, “You are not ready for how amazing this game is going to be.”

North has worked on comic books like The Unbeatable Squirrel Girl, Jughead and Adventure Time but is perhaps best known for the webcomic Dinosaur Comics. He won multiple Eisner Awards and even wrote the story for Zoink’s Lost in Random, which Electronic Arts published in 2021 for consoles and PC as part of the EA Originals label.

Motive’s Iron Man title doesn’t have a release window or announced platforms. It’s confirmed to be a single-player game with an original story “tied to Tony Stark and channeling his charisma.” The developer wants to deliver a “super high production value AAA experience,” with a recent job ad suggesting the title could be open-world. Stay tuned for more details in the coming months, especially since rumors claim it’s releasing before EA’s Black Panther game.
